Marks Breakdown
Written Total
824
Interview
162
Grand Total
986
| Paper | Marks |
|---|---|
| Essay | 110 |
| General Studies I | 109 |
| General Studies II | 110 |
| General Studies III | 89 |
| General Studies IV | 117 |
| Optional Paper I | 143 |
| Optional Paper II | 146 |
